Frequently Asked Questions about vacation rentals in Derbyshire

  • What are the must-see sights in Derbyshire, United Kingdom?

    Derbyshire boasts many iconic sights. Chatsworth House, a stately home with stunning gardens, is a must. Peak District National Park offers breathtaking scenery, including Mam Tor and the dramatic cliffs of Stanage Edge. For history buffs, there's the charming town of Bakewell, famous for its Bakewell tart, and the ruins of Bolsover Castle.

  • Are there unique natural phenomena in Derbyshire, United Kingdom?

    Absolutely! The Peak District's dramatic limestone pavements are a unique geological feature. You'll also find impressive caves like the Peak Cavern (also known as the Devil's Arse) and Speedwell Cavern, showcasing Derbyshire's karst landscape. The area's diverse flora and fauna, including rare birds and wildflowers, add to its natural wonders.

  • What are some less-famous attractions in Derbyshire, United Kingdom that are worth a visit?

    Consider exploring the picturesque villages of Castleton and Eyam, both with rich history. The Tissington Trail, a former railway line converted into a walking and cycling path, offers stunning scenery. For a unique experience, visit the Heights of Abraham, offering cable car rides and stunning views.

  • How many days are ideal for visiting Derbyshire, United Kingdom, and what are some itinerary suggestions?

    Three to five days allows for a good exploration of Derbyshire's highlights. A possible itinerary could include: Day 1: Chatsworth House and Bakewell; Day 2: Peak District hiking (Mam Tor); Day 3: Castleton and the caves; Day 4: Explore a smaller village and enjoy the local pubs; Day 5: Heights of Abraham and return journey.
